The National Monuments Service's description
In poorly drained area of improved pasture, on a very gentle WNW-facing slope. Gentle, oval depression (dims. c. 3m NE-SW; c. 2.5m NW-SE; Dth c. 0.05m). Long drain (long axis NE-SW; Wth c. 2m) extends from SW-side. Depression likely indicates natural spring. Named 'Killeen well' on latest edition OS 6-inch map.
